True Love by Elizabeth Arden

For: women Designer: Elizabeth Arden Olfactive Group: Oriental Floral

True Love by Elizabeth Arden is a oriental floral fragrance for women. True Love was launched in 1994. The nose behind this fragrance is Sophia Grojsman. Top notes are apricot, green notes, freesia and peach; middle notes are iris, orris root, jasmine, heliotrope, lily-of-the-valley and rose; base notes are sandalwood, amber, vanilla and cedar.
